Skip to content
Permalink
Branch: master
Find file Copy path
Find file Copy path
Fetching contributors…
Cannot retrieve contributors at this time
82 lines (80 sloc) 1.77 KB
---
default:
- entity: light.dummy
- icon: mdi:light-switch
- name: dummy
- lock: false
- tap_action:
action: toggle
- hold_action:
action: more-info
- show_state: true
- type: icon
card:
# type: entity-button
# entity: "[[entity]]"
# icon: "[[icon]]"
# name: "[[name]]"
# tap_action: "[[tap_action]]"
# hold_action: "[[hold_action]]"
type: custom:button-card
color_type: "[[type]]"
entity: "[[entity]]"
name: "[[name]]"
tap_action: "[[tap_action]]"
hold_action: "[[hold_action]]"
show_state: "[[show_state]]"
icon: "[[icon]]"
lock:
enabled: "[[lock]]"
styles:
grid:
- grid-template-areas: '"i" "n" "s"'
- grid-template-columns: 1fr
- grid-template-rows: 1fr min-content min-content
img_cell:
- align-self: start
- text-align: start
name:
- justify-self: start
- padding-left: 10px
- font-weight: bold
- text-transform: lowercase
state:
- justify-self: start
- padding-left: 10px
state:
- value: unlocked
icon: mdi:lock-open
- value: locked
icon: mdi:lock
styles:
card:
- filter: opacity(50%)
icon:
- filter: grayscale(100%)
- value: 'off'
styles:
card:
- filter: opacity(50%)
icon:
- filter: grayscale(100%)
- value: unavailable
styles:
card:
- filter: opacity(25%)
icon:
- filter: grayscale(100%)
- value: closed
styles:
card:
- filter: opacity(50%)
icon:
- filter: grayscale(100%)
- value: open
icon: >
[[[
if (entity.entity_id == "cover.garage_door")
return "mdi:garage-open";
return "[[icon]]";
]]]
You can’t perform that action at this time.